Position COMMUNITY MANAGER
The Community Manager is responsible for overseeing the entire operations of a housing community under the supervision of the Regional Manager. You will manage all phases of operations, including personnel, leasing, maintenance, financial, administration & risk management. As an on-site leader, you will supervise all aspects of the property and staff to ensure compliance with Asset Living policies and procedures, safety and fair housing guidelines, and liability concerns.
Essential Duties & Responsibilities Personnel Management
Regular / daily onsite attendance is required
Screen, hire, train, coach, and develop on-site staff using consistent techniques and company directives
Ensure staff effectiveness through ongoing training, coaching, counseling, and guidance in compliance with Asset training benchmarks
Complete weekly / daily office and maintenance staff schedules and assignments
Address performance problems with appropriate documentation and communication with supervisor and HR; terminate when necessary
Promote harmony and quality job performance through support and effective leadership
Ensure staff compliance with Company policies and procedures
Financial Management
Aim to maximize net operating income through cost control and revenue & leasing improvements; identify trends and recommend strategies
Develop yearly operating budgets / forecasts
Monitor timely receipt and reconciliation of deposits, rent collections, and charges
Monitor timely receipt, reconciliation, and coding of all vendor invoices
Ensure property closeout is completed on time and ownership financial reports are accurate
Strategic Leasing Management
Develop yearly marketing plan and utilize marketing strategies & systems
Ensure leasing techniques are effective in obtaining closures and that reporting systems are accurate and up to date
Handle resident complaints and requests to ensure resident satisfaction
Develop and implement resident retention programs
Show, lease, and move-in prospective residents
Administrative & Maintenance Management
Ensure all administrative & leasing reporting is accurate and submitted on time
Lead the emergency team and respond to property emergencies within company guidelines
Manage customer service and maintenance service request responsiveness
Maintain property appearance and ensure timely repairs with regular inspections
Allocate property resources, obtain bids, and manage vendors and contractors
Direct maintenance, construction, and rehabilitation activities to ensure quality and expediency

Education / experience : High School Diploma or Equivalent; Bachelor’s degree preferred or four years of housing industry experience; or related experience or training; or equivalent
Certified Apartment Manager (CAM) or Accredited Resident Manager (ARM) preferred
Basic computer skills and on-site software familiarity; Basic knowledge of Fair Housing Laws and OSHA requirements
Physical Requirements Ability to communicate clearly; may require overtime, weekends, and night hours (emergencies)
Ability to remain stationary or move as needed; crawl or climb as required by tasks
May ascend / descend ladders, stairs, and operate tools; may lift up to 25 lbs; work in various environments
License / Equipment Must have reliable transportation due to on-call requirements
Compensation and Benefits Asset Living offers a total rewards package including benefits (medical, dental, vision, life, accidental and disability insurance), 401K with employer matching, commissions and performance bonuses where applicable, and paid sick days and company holidays for full-time employees.
Salary Range : $31.15 per hour to $34.97 per hour
